What is VA Home Instruction

The Virginia Home Instruction Notice is an education form used by parents in Virginia to inform the local school district of their intent to homeschool their children.

Understanding the Virginia Home Instruction Notice

The Virginia Home Instruction Notice is a crucial form for parents in Virginia who decide to educate their children at home. This document serves as an essential notification to local school districts regarding the parents' intention to provide home education, laying the foundation for compliance with local regulations. It is important for parents to understand that this notice must be filed annually to maintain their homeschooling status.
By filing the Virginia Home Instruction Notice, parents officially inform their local school district about their intent to homeschool, ensuring they meet Virginia's homeschooling requirements.

Key Features of the Virginia Home Instruction Notice

The Virginia Home Instruction Notice includes vital components that parents must complete accurately. Required fields include the names and birthdates of the children being homeschooled, along with qualifications for providing home instruction.
  • Filing deadline: The notice must be submitted annually by August 15th.
  • Requirements include parents' signatures and dates certifying the information provided.

Any parent or legal guardian residing in Virginia who intends to provide home instruction for their children is eligible to submit the Virginia Home Instruction Notice.
The Virginia Home Instruction Notice must be submitted annually by August 15th of each year to the local school district for homeschooling notifications.
You can submit the Virginia Home Instruction Notice electronically through platforms like pdfFiller, or print and mail it to the contact address of your local school district.
While the Virginia Home Instruction Notice primarily requires the names and birthdates of children and qualifications, additional documentation may be required to show educational achievements by August 1st of the following year.
Common mistakes include missing required fields, submitting the form after the deadline, or failing to provide evidence of educational achievement. Double-check for completeness before submitting.
Processing times can vary by school district, but it generally takes a few weeks after submission. It is advisable to follow up with the district if no confirmation is received.
Once the Virginia Home Instruction Notice has been submitted, it typically cannot be modified. If changes are necessary, you may need to submit a new notice to your school district.
